LCMX02-1200HC-4TG100CR1 是 Lattice Semiconductor(莱迪思半导体)推出的一款 MachXO2 系列的非易失性可编程逻辑器件(CPLD/FPGA)。该器件结合了高性能、低功耗和高集成度,适用于多种接口桥接、I/O扩展、系统控制和通信协议转换等应用。LCMX02-1200HC-4TG100CR1 的型号中,"LCMX02" 表示 MachXO2 系列,"1200" 表示逻辑单元数量为约1200个,"HC" 表示高性能配置,"4" 表示速度等级为-4(即较快的器件),"TG100C" 表示封装类型为100引脚 TQFP,"R1" 表示卷带包装。
类型:非易失性FPGA(CPLD)
逻辑单元数量:约1200个
封装类型:100引脚 TQFP
速度等级:-4
工作温度范围:工业级(-40°C 至 +85°C)
I/O数量:67
嵌入式存储器:32KB
锁相环(PLL):2个
电源电压:2.375V 至 3.465V
非易失性存储器:128位加密位流加密
用户闪存(UFM):128KB
封装类型:TQFP
LCMX02-1200HC-4TG100CR1 是 MachXO2 系列中的一款高性能可编程逻辑器件,具备以下主要特性:
1. 非易失性架构:该器件采用 Flash 技术,无需外部配置芯片,上电即运行,简化了系统设计并提高了可靠性。
2. 丰富的逻辑资源:拥有约1200个逻辑单元,支持复杂的状态机设计和多功能实现,适用于多种控制和接口转换应用。
3. 多种I/O接口支持:提供67个用户可配置I/O引脚,支持多种电平标准(如LVCMOS、LVDS、PCIe、SPI等),便于与其他系统元件连接。
4. 高速性能:-4速度等级确保了器件在高频应用中的稳定性,适用于需要快速响应的实时控制系统。
5. 安全性:支持128位位流加密,保护设计代码不被非法复制或读取,适用于对安全性要求较高的场景。
6. 嵌入式存储器:提供32KB的嵌入式RAM资源,可用于数据缓冲、查找表或状态机设计,提高系统集成度。
7. 用户闪存(UFM):128KB的用户可编程闪存可用于存储非易失性数据,如设备序列号、校准参数或固件更新。
8. 系统级功能:内置2个锁相环(PLL),支持灵活的时钟管理,包括频率合成、相位调节和时钟切换。
9. 低功耗设计:MachXO2系列采用先进的低功耗架构,支持多种电源管理模式,适用于电池供电或绿色电子产品设计。
10. 开发工具支持:Lattice Diamond 和 Lattice Radiant 软件支持该器件的设计输入、综合、布局布线及调试,提供了完整的开发环境。
LCMX02-1200HC-4TG100CR1 广泛应用于多个领域,主要包括:
1. 通信设备:用于实现通信协议转换、接口桥接、时钟管理等功能,如以太网到UART、SPI到I2C等转换器。
2. 工业控制:用于PLC、传感器接口、电机控制、HMI(人机界面)等工业自动化系统中的逻辑控制和I/O扩展。
3. 消费类电子产品:用于智能家电、可穿戴设备、智能家居控制器等产品中的系统管理和低功耗控制逻辑。
4. 汽车电子:用于车载信息娱乐系统、ADAS(高级驾驶辅助系统)、车身控制模块等场景中的接口管理和逻辑控制。
5. 测试与测量设备:用于测试仪器、信号发生器、数据采集系统中的状态机控制和协议解析。
6. 医疗设备:用于便携式医疗仪器、生命体征监测设备、远程诊断设备中的系统控制和数据处理。
7. 网络与服务器:用于网络交换机、路由器、服务器管理模块中的硬件控制和系统初始化逻辑。
LCMX02-1200HC-5TG100C
LCMX02-7000HE-4TG144C
LCMX02-2000HC-4TG100C